Default Grinding noise

HI all, my 95 wrx ra has developed a grinding noise coming from the transmission. It started off sounding rotational but now is more a constant grinding, it developed very quickly in the space of about 3 miles and it gets louder with speed.
So after getting it recovered home i jacked it up and checked all the usual i.e driveshafts, wheel bearings and so on but the sound was coming from the back of the box. So i got googling and searching on here and it looked like it was either the center diff or the transfer case bearing but after stripping it all down they both seem fine i.e spinning freely and running smooth.

I've now taken the tranfer case off so i could look deeper into the box and have found the gold ring at the end of the main shaft(5th gear syncro i think?) is very loose.
Are the syncros if thats what it is meant to be loose while not under load? or is this what is causing the grinding noise?
